Top 5 Best 93710 California Public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 7 public schools serving 4,626 students in 93710, CA (there are , serving 218 private students). 95% of all K-12 students in 93710, CA are educated in public schools (compared to the CA state average of 90%).
The top ranked public schools in 93710, CA are Eaton Elementary School, Mccardle Elementary School and Robinson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public schools in zipcode 93710 have an average math proficiency score of 19% (versus the California public school average of 33%), and reading proficiency score of 34% (versus the 47% statewide average). Schools in 93710, CA have an average ranking of 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of California public schools.
Minority enrollment is 88%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the California public school average of 80% (majority Hispanic).
